The Ultimate Guide: How Does T Gel Shampoo Work for Your Scalp?

T/Gel shampoo is a popular choice for people struggling with scalp conditions like dandruff and seborrheic dermatitis. But how does it actually work? Understanding the science behind T/Gel can help you make informed decisions about your hair care routine.

The Science Behind T/Gel: Coal Tar and Its Properties

T/Gel shampoo owes its effectiveness to a key ingredient: coal tar. This ingredient might sound a bit intimidating, but it has been used for centuries to treat skin conditions. Coal tar is a complex mixture of hydrocarbons derived from the distillation of coal.

Here’s how coal tar works:

  • Anti-inflammatory properties: Coal tar helps reduce inflammation on the scalp, which is a common factor in dandruff and seborrheic dermatitis.
  • Anti-proliferative effects: Coal tar slows down the growth of skin cells, preventing the buildup of dead skin cells that contribute to dandruff.
  • Anti-fungal activity: Coal tar has antifungal properties that can help control the growth of Malassezia globosa, a fungus often associated with dandruff.

The Application: Getting the Most Out of T/Gel

To maximize the benefits of T/Gel shampoo, follow these steps:

1. Wet your hair thoroughly.
2. Apply a small amount of T/Gel shampoo to your scalp.
3. Gently massage the shampoo into your scalp.
4. Leave the shampoo on for a few minutes.
5. Rinse thoroughly.
6. Repeat as needed.

The Results: Expecting Change

T/Gel shampoo is not a quick fix. It may take several weeks of regular use to see noticeable improvement in your scalp condition. Be patient and consistent with your application.

The Cautions: Potential Side Effects

While generally safe, T/Gel shampoo can cause some side effects in certain individuals. These may include:

  • Skin irritation: Coal tar can irritate the skin, especially if used too frequently or in excessive amounts.
  • Hair discoloration: Coal tar can temporarily darken hair, especially blonde or gray hair.
  • Sun sensitivity: Coal tar can make your skin more sensitive to sunlight.

If you experience any adverse reactions, stop using T/Gel shampoo and consult a dermatologist.

Q: How often should I use T/Gel shampoo?

A: The frequency of use depends on the severity of your scalp condition and your individual response to the shampoo. Generally, it is recommended to use T/Gel shampoo 2-3 times per week.

Q: Can I use T/Gel shampoo on color-treated hair?

A: While T/Gel shampoo can temporarily darken hair, it is generally safe to use on color-treated hair. However, it is always a good idea to consult with your stylist or dermatologist before using any new hair care products.

Q: Is T/Gel shampoo safe for pregnant women?

A: It is best to consult with your doctor or a dermatologist before using T/Gel shampoo during pregnancy. While coal tar is generally safe, it is important to weigh the potential benefits and risks.

Q: How long does it take to see results from using T/Gel shampoo?

A: It may take several weeks of regular use to see noticeable improvement in your scalp condition. Be patient and consistent with your application.

Q: Can I use T/Gel shampoo on children?

A: T/Gel shampoo is not recommended for children under 12 years of age unless directed by a doctor.
